Transaction 64a6423f76b41effc256224f1b9744740937f1b92a2e2a2b1d2b5cfae488967a

1 Input
2 Outputs
  • 64a6423f76b41effc256224f1b9744740937f1b92a2e2a2b1d2b5cfae488967a:0
  • value  1302075
    address  3AzVkaG9fyXsWTqL7tvSmyaoHvrn3qJiX7
  • 64a6423f76b41effc256224f1b9744740937f1b92a2e2a2b1d2b5cfae488967a:1
  • value  17583131
    address  bc1qlsurjn8fdhpcs3p97q3369xxszcchkkt5r7cv0